Example #1
0
 private void polizaToolStripMenuItem1_Click(object sender, EventArgs e)
 {
     Polizas.Polizas poliza = new Polizas.Polizas();
     poliza.Show();
     poliza.AsignarQuery(
         " select 'COMPRAS' as Cuenta, round((select sum(precio_unitario) from ordenes_compras_detalle), 2) as debe, '0' as haber " +
         " union all " +
         " select 'BANCOS' as Cuenta, '0' as debe, round((select sum(precio_unitario) from ordenes_compras_detalle), 2) as haber; ");
     poliza.AsignarColores(Color.FromArgb(175, 207, 138), Color.Black);
 }
Example #2
0
        private void polizaToolStripMenuItem_Click_1(object sender, EventArgs e)
        {
            Polizas.Polizas poliza = new Polizas.Polizas();
            poliza.Show();
            poliza.AsignarQuery(
                " select 'COMPRAS' as Cuenta, " +
                " round(COALESCE((select sum(MOV_DET.precio_producto) as debe from " +
                " movimientos_inventario_detalle MOV_DET " +
                " join movimientos_inventario_encabezado MOV_ENC using (id_movimiento_inventario_encabezado) " +
                " join tipos_movimientos TIPO_MOV using (id_tipo_movimiento) " +
                " where TIPO_MOV.nombre_tipo_movimiento = 'Compra' ), 2)) as debe, " +
                " '0' as haber " +
                " union all " +
                " select 'BANCOS' as Cuenta, " +
                " '0' as debe,  " +
                " round(COALESCE((select sum(MOV_DET.precio_producto) as debe from " +
                " movimientos_inventario_detalle MOV_DET " +
                " join movimientos_inventario_encabezado MOV_ENC using (id_movimiento_inventario_encabezado) " +
                " join tipos_movimientos TIPO_MOV using (id_tipo_movimiento) " +
                " where TIPO_MOV.nombre_tipo_movimiento = 'Compra' ), 2)) as haber " +
                " union all " +
                " select 'VENTAS' as Cuenta, " +
                " '0' as debe,  " +
                " round(COALESCE((select sum(MOV_DET.precio_producto) as debe from " +
                " movimientos_inventario_detalle MOV_DET " +
                " join movimientos_inventario_encabezado MOV_ENC using (id_movimiento_inventario_encabezado) " +
                " join tipos_movimientos TIPO_MOV using (id_tipo_movimiento) " +
                " where TIPO_MOV.nombre_tipo_movimiento = 'Venta' ), 2)) as haber " +
                " union all " +
                " select 'CAJA' as Cuenta,  " +
                " round(COALESCE((select sum(MOV_DET.precio_producto) as debe from " +
                " movimientos_inventario_detalle MOV_DET " +
                " join movimientos_inventario_encabezado MOV_ENC using (id_movimiento_inventario_encabezado) " +
                " join tipos_movimientos TIPO_MOV using (id_tipo_movimiento) " +
                " where TIPO_MOV.nombre_tipo_movimiento = 'Venta' ), 2)) as debe, " +
                " '0' as haber; ");


            poliza.AsignarColores(Color.FromArgb(175, 207, 138), Color.Black);
        }